So for starters this is hands down one of the best post anyone has made in the forums in a long time, and as far as history and people go, I would like to name a few.....

A- Azreil- One of the forefront military minds, alliance leader and key player in a major war. 

B-Boromir- Tourney extraordinaire, and held the lead on overall attack score for a long time. 
(Honorable mentions: Baynights, Beecks)

C- Cranesrule/Boru- Military Juggernaut, diplomatic leader extremely knowledgable and is an OG in illy.

D- Dave83- Major player in the military might of Shade my previous alliance. Him and his alt were always down for a scrap. 
(Honorable mention: Dittobite)

E-Ellisande- Frequent helper in GC and my favorite thing was everytime you seen her in chat Mananan would be in there to give here a rose.
(Honorable mention: Eragon, Emily Jade)

F- Fluffy- The original troll lol. Renamed his account to read that it was abandoned so he could then defend the seiges from people who thought they were taking over an inactive!

G-GodsDestroyer- We use to always empty the market of all the beer before traders were a thing and then barter our goods in GC instead of the typical market transactions. Miss you buddy 
(Honorable mention: Gratch)

H- Honored Mule- We didnt always see eye to eye, but he was a illy great- creator of tools that helped the community, and one of the pillars of Harmless who stood as the beacon of dominance in the illy landscape for years. 

I- Indomitable- Coleader of Toothless, all around nice player and helpful to countless number of newbs
(Honorable mention:Innoble)

J- Jane Dark Magic- Even though we never met she went to college 30 minutes away from me and we shared the same love for Greeks Pizza!
(Honorable Mention:Jasche)

K- Another great Illy trader and long time stay in T?. She would frequent GC with saddles asking to sell to people at a discount
(Honorable Mention: Kale Weathers)

L- ladyLuvs- You never see her venture into global chat aanymore but a great character, big heart and longtime helper in the community. Illy needs more people like LL

M- Manochander/Madmano- I bet this guy has funded illy more prestige than anybody. Mano was a huge piece of my previous alliances and would eat through prestige like it was candy. 
(Honorable mention:Magnificence, malek)

N- Nokigon- Avid member of GC, very loyal and frequently would help people with capturing new towns

O- Olek- Always in GC trying to figure out the game mechanics of seiges and raids, in hindsight he probably was a year before his time. He could have been a great fit when the game started becoming more militarily dominant

P- Purple Rain- Great player but like most of the former alliance Pending, hated wars. Just looked forward to playing in tourneys and was very good at that

Q- Queen Bikini- Alliance leader, thorn in my side. I felt like we were always on opposing sides of a conflict. Good sport when it came to fighting though, her and Roman Empire

R- Rill- Love her or hate her she was a trooper. Rain sleet or snow, Rill was on illy. It got to the point people started disliking her because there wasnt a time you could go into GC and there wasnt a comment from Rill in the feed. One of the most knowledgeable and helpful players illy has probably ever had, and the community suffers from people like her no longer playing their roles.
(Honorable Mention:Ryklaw,Ryelle :)

S- Sheogorath- member of the freemorn society which was doing things way before they were popular in the game. The alliance required you to move into their hub area of Freemorn in order to remain a member, unfortunately Sheo was pretty young and didn't have the patience for the long-term game that is Illyriad.
(Honorable Mentions: Scaramouche,Sir Bradley, Susan Calvin)

T-The_Dude- The first thing that comes to mind is dramatic. The_Dude went on a tirade about a player Mananan and then because he didnt get what he wanted spent the next 2 weeks in GC giving away his goods while seiging himself down to nothing with his alt account El-Jeffe. I guess at the end of the day it was a bit entertaining 
(Honorable Mentions:tanis, Tordenkaffen)

Y- Yearick- Founder of one of the earliest alliances, well rounded player(I believe finrod was his alt if memory serves) with excellent diplomacy and recruiting skills, unfortunately inactivity struck and these accounts were shells for a long time. 

Z- Zolvon- Leader of a old alliance, and one of the older players in the game. He and his brother came over to join up with me in Shade as a result to end a war and save his brother in real life Magnificence from being seiged to 0. After awhile Z had to head back to his own alliance cause he refuses to be ruled by anyone.

As an aside from the above mentioned players Id also like to mention some of my favorite older alliances that are no longer active, Curse the Wolves, The Grey Grudges, and Warriors of the New. All of which i have stories directly related to, but I never was a governing piece of them.

B: BayNights

My history with BayNights started when a brave bunch of warriors set out to challenge the fearmongering alliance, that had notoriously started a theme in the game, and put their minds to being the military alliance in The Broken Lands to dominate. SIN of course. Strategies had to be thought out and BayNights was a good mind to have in these matters. Acivity is key, as in a lot of other games, and this dude is active and slaughters other military players with his cunning and deterministic playstyle. 
It ain't a surprise to anybody though, that SIN weren't exactly beat back when an alliance called STOMPS were formed, who had players like Pico, BayNights, AianNick and a couple other warriors who wanted to fight in the name of fairplay and didn't want to see this warmongering fear alliance, SIN, be succesful.
Ultimately the fight is not over, but the tables have been turned several times. Lots of the warriors who were previously alligned with one side or the other, have been shifting around to create as much fun as possible for all involved participants as time has passed. Keep up the good work!
